What makes the most effective cloud monitoring instruments: My standards

To separate the most effective from the remainder, I centered on key components that outline efficient, dependable, and scalable cloud monitoring. 

  • Actual-time efficiency monitoring: Cloud environments are dynamic, and efficiency bottlenecks can escalate shortly. I regarded for instruments that present real-time visibility into CPU, reminiscence, community visitors, and storage utilization throughout cloud workloads. One of the best options supply granular monitoring on the occasion, container, and Kubernetes pod ranges to detect anomalies earlier than they influence purposes.
  • Clever alerting and automation: Alert fatigue is an actual downside. A very good cloud monitoring instrument ought to prioritize vital alerts and suppress noisy, low-priority ones. I regarded for platforms that assist AI-driven anomaly detection, threshold-based alerting, and auto-remediation capabilities, akin to auto-scaling sources or restarting failed cases with out guide intervention.
  • Multi-cloud and hybrid cloud assist: Most companies use a number of cloud suppliers, however not all monitoring instruments can deal with that complexity. I prioritized options that natively assist AWS, Azure, Google Cloud, and hybrid deployments with out requiring extreme configuration. Cross-cloud visibility, unified dashboards, and API integrations had been key components on this analysis.
  • Safety and compliance monitoring: Cloud environments introduce new assault surfaces, so monitoring ought to embody safety posture evaluation, misconfiguration detection, and compliance auditing for frameworks like SOC 2, ISO 27001, HIPAA, and PCI DSS. One of the best instruments transcend primary logs and embody menace detection, id monitoring, and automatic safety coverage enforcement.
  • Log administration and distributed tracing: In trendy cloud-native environments, logs and traces present vital insights. I regarded for options that assist centralized log aggregation, real-time log evaluation, and distributed tracing to pinpoint bottlenecks in microservices architectures. One of the best platforms combine with ELK Stack, OpenTelemetry, or native log providers like AWS CloudTrail.
  • Ease of deployment and integration: A monitoring instrument ought to work out of the field with out requiring hours of setup. I prioritized options with agentless monitoring choices, easy API-based integrations, and assist for containerized workloads in Kubernetes environments. The flexibility to combine with DevOps instruments like Terraform, Prometheus, and CI/CD pipelines was additionally a key issue.
  • Price optimization and useful resource administration: Cloud payments can spiral uncontrolled with out correct monitoring. I regarded for instruments that supply value analytics, anomaly detection for surprising spikes, and useful resource right-sizing suggestions to get rid of wasted cloud spend. One of the best platforms present predictive insights that assist IT groups optimize resource allocation earlier than prices escalate.

Steadily requested questions (FAQ) on cloud monitoring instruments

1. What’s cloud monitoring?

Cloud monitoring is the method of monitoring and analyzing cloud infrastructure, purposes, and providers to make sure efficiency, safety, and availability. Utilizing cloud monitoring instruments, IT groups can detect points like slowdowns, outages, and safety vulnerabilities earlier than they influence customers. These instruments present real-time insights into cloud sources akin to servers, databases, and networks.

2. What are the most effective cloud monitoring instruments?

The greatest cloud monitoring instruments supply real-time efficiency monitoring, automated alerting, safety monitoring, and value optimization options. Some prime choices embody Datadog, AWS CloudWatch, Dynatrace, and LogicMonitor. The suitable instrument relies on whether or not you want cloud utility monitoring instruments, cloud safety monitoring instruments, or cloud infrastructure monitoring instruments for multi-cloud environments.

3. How do cloud monitoring providers work?

Cloud monitoring providers accumulate and analyze efficiency metrics from cloud-based sources akin to digital machines, containers, and purposes. These instruments use log administration, community monitoring, and anomaly detection to supply visibility into cloud well being and safety. Some platforms, like AWS CloudWatch and Azure Monitor, are cloud-native, whereas others, like New Relic and Datadog, assist multi-cloud monitoring.

4. How do cloud efficiency monitoring instruments enhance effectivity?

Cloud efficiency monitoring instruments monitor key metrics like CPU utilization, reminiscence consumption, disk I/O, and utility response instances to make sure optimum efficiency. They assist stop slowdowns, cut back downtime, and routinely scale sources based mostly on demand, making them important for DevOps and IT operations groups.

5. What are multi-cloud monitoring instruments?

Multi-cloud monitoring instruments permit IT groups to handle and monitor workloads throughout a number of cloud suppliers, akin to A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ud, from a single dashboard. These instruments supply cross-platform efficiency monitoring, value evaluation, and safety monitoring, serving to companies preserve constant efficiency throughout completely different cloud environments.

6. What are the most effective AWS cloud monitoring instruments?

One of the best AWS cloud monitoring instruments embody each native AWS providers and third-party options. AWS CloudWatch supplies built-in efficiency monitoring and logging for AWS sources, whereas AWS CloudTrail focuses on safety and compliance by monitoring API exercise. Different native instruments include AWS  Config, Inspector, and Safety Hub.

For extra superior monitoring, third-party instruments like Datadog, New Relic, Dynatrace, and LogicMonitor supply deeper observability, AI-powered insights, and multi-cloud assist.

7. What are the most effective Azure cloud monitoring instruments?

Like AWS, the most effective Azure cloud monitoring instruments embody each native Azure providers and third-party options. Azure Monitor is the first built-in instrument for monitoring efficiency, safety, and logs throughout Azure sources, whereas Azure Safety Heart focuses on menace detection and compliance monitoring. For extra superior observability, third-party instruments like Datadog, New Relic, Dynatrace, and LogicMonitor supply deeper insights, AI-driven anomaly detection, and multi-cloud compatibility.

8. What are the most effective open-source cloud monitoring instruments?

A number of the greatest open-source cloud monitoring instruments embody Prometheus, Zabbix, Nagios, Grafana, and VictoriaMetrics.

Prometheus is broadly used for metrics-based monitoring in cloud-native environments, whereas Zabbix and Nagios supply full-stack infrastructure monitoring.

Grafana is a robust visualization instrument that integrates with numerous knowledge sources, and VictoriaMetrics supplies a high-performance various to Prometheus for large-scale monitoring.

Whereas these instruments get rid of licensing prices, they require guide setup, upkeep, and configuration, making them ideally suited for groups with the sources to handle an open-source answer.

Eyes on the cloud

In the case of the cloud, I agree that the extra complicated the surroundings, the simpler it’s to lose monitor of prices, efficiency bottlenecks, and safety dangers. However I strongly insist that affordability and necessity ought to information your selection of a cloud monitoring instrument.

Ask your self: Why do you want monitoring? What are you monitoring? And what worth do you anticipate from it? These non-functional features are exhausting to cost however vital for budgeting.

When you’re monitoring a single app producing $10K/month, a $2K/month monitoring instrument may not be justified. However if you happen to’re managing a dozen apps driving $500K/month, that funding might repay by enhancing uptime, decreasing upkeep prices, and scaling effectively.

For giant-scale enterprises, premium options like Dynatrace or Datadog automate workflows and enhance response instances. But when value is a priority, open-source choices like Prometheus, Grafana Labs, Zabbix, or VictoriaMetrics are higher.

On the finish of the day, selecting a cloud monitoring instrument isn’t nearly options. It’s about aligning together with your operational wants, funds, and long-term technique. The suitable instrument ought to offer you confidence in your infrastructure, not simply one other dashboard to stare at.
